Formula Explained

The calculator relies on a proportional conversion: whatever fraction of sugar exists in the labeled serving is assumed to apply to any other weight of the same food. This is the standard way nutrition databases express food composition, and it lets you compare products that come in oddly sized packages.

Sugar per 100 g = (sugar in labeled serving ÷ labeled serving weight) × 100

Sugar in your portion = sugar per 100 g × (your portion weight ÷ 100)

Suppose a 150 g serving of sweetened soy yogurt contains 9 g of sugar. Sugar per 100 g is (9 ÷ 150) × 100 = 6 g. If you eat a 120 g portion, the sugar in that portion is 6 × (120 ÷ 100) = 7.2 g. You can run the same logic in reverse: a product that lists 4 g of sugar per 100 g contributes 4 × (250 ÷ 100) = 10 g of sugar in a 250 g container.

Step-by-Step Walkthrough

Imagine you have a pack of seasoned tofu. The label states that a 90 g serving contains 2.7 g of sugar, and you plan to eat the entire 270 g pack.

Step 1 — Sugar per 100 g: (2.7 ÷ 90) × 100 = 3.0 g

Step 2 — Sugar in your portion: 3.0 × (270 ÷ 100) = 8.1 g

Step 3 — Sugar per 50 g: 3.0 ÷ 2 = 1.5 g

The tool performs all three conversions instantly, which is especially handy when you are comparing several brands side by side and want every product expressed on the same 100 g scale.

Typical Sugar Values

Soy foodTypical sugar per 100 g
Cooked soybeans3.6 g
Steamed edamame2.2 g
Firm tofu0.6 g
Silken tofu1.2 g
Unsweetened soy milk0.4 g
Sweetened soy milk4 g
Tempeh0 g
Miso6.2 g
Plain soy yogurt1.5 g

These figures are typical values drawn from food composition databases such as USDA FoodData Central and common product labels. They are meant as a starting point, not a promise: flavored soy yogurt, chocolate soy milk, and teriyaki-marinated tofu can easily contain two to five times more sugar than their plain counterparts. The USDA's FoodData Central is a free authoritative source if you want precise numbers for generic foods.

Common Mistakes to Avoid

  • Entering the whole package weight. Use the serving size printed on the nutrition panel, not the total weight of the carton or pack. A 1 L soy milk carton contains many servings.
  • Double-converting per-100 g values. If your label already lists sugar per 100 g, enter 100 as the serving size and leave the sugar number as printed — do not convert it again.
  • Assuming every soy food is low in sugar. Plain tofu and tempeh are naturally near zero, but sweetened soy milk, miso, and dessert-style soy yogurts can carry meaningful sugar.
  • Ignoring added sugars. Some labels list total sugars and added sugars separately. This calculator works with total sugar; if you only want added sugar, enter that number instead.
  • Mixing 100 ml with 100 g. For thin beverages the two are nearly identical, but for thicker products like miso or soy yogurt, always weigh the food.

Limitations

This tool estimates sugar content from the label information you provide. It does not separate naturally occurring sugars from added sugars unless you enter only the added-sugar figure. It also does not track moisture changes from cooking — boiling edamame or pressing tofu changes water content, which can slightly shift the sugar concentration per 100 g. Brand formulations, regional recipes, and sweetener types all create real variation, so always treat the results as estimates for educational purposes.

What about sugar alcohols or artificial sweeteners? Sugar alcohols such as erythritol are not counted as sugar on most labels, and artificial sweeteners contribute zero sugar. The calculator follows the label's own sugar definition, so you get the same answer the manufacturer reports.
